Auteur |
Onderwerp |
|
robpnl
Netherlands
22 berichten |
Geplaatst - 17 dec 2007 : 15:52:18
|
Helaas ben ik niet zo ruim behuisd. Mijn baantje meet daarom slechts 2,5 bij 1,5 meter, maar ik heb deze ruimte 'creatief' benut. In mijn database (robpnl.bck; heb ik ge-upload) vormen de blokken 6, 7 en 8 een station. De blokken 1 tm 5 zijn niet zichtbaar (in berg). Mijn motief is Zwitserland, dus ik rijdt links. De binnenronde wordt gevormd door de blokken 1, 2, 6 en 7. De keerlus (blok 5) houdt ik even buiten beschouwing. Stel de volgende situatie met twee loks; beide rijdend op variabele route 'binnendoor, zonder keerlus; mode automatisch rijden (F8). Ik start het automatisch rijden door elke lok naar een vrij blok te sturen. Als de loks de blokken bereikt hebben, vervolgen ze hun weg naar keuze (volgens variabele route 'binnendoor, zonder keerlus'). Al snel loopt het vast doordat ze op elkaar gaan staan wachten. Lok 1 staat bijvoorbeeld in blok 1 te wachten tot blok 6 vrij komt. Terwijl lok 2 in blok 6 juist wacht tot tot blok 1 vrij komt. Dit alles terwijl blok 2 en blok 7 gewoon vrij zijn en er in principe gewoon gereden zou moeten kunnen worden. Dit is een soort deadlock, maar ik weet niet hoe hier uit te komen. Kan iemand mij hierbij helpen? Hoe is de filosofie van Koploper bij het zoeken van een weg binnen een variabele route? Wordt als er uit meerdere wegen gekozen kan worden niet automatisch een vrije gekozen? Hoeveel blokken wordt hierbij vooruit gekeken?
hopelijk kan iemand mij een stuk op weg helpen.
groet, Rob Peters
Download Attachment: robpnl.bck 47,51 KB |
Bewerkt door robpnl op 17 dec 2007 15:54:38 |
|
Wissels
Netherlands
1450 Posts |
Geplaatst - 17 dec 2007 : 18:08:27
|
Hallo Rob,
ik denk dat dit door je variabele routes is ontstaan, waar heel veel richting verboden inzitten. Als je dit uischakeld in een rijwindow zal de loc vermoedelijk wel een vrij spoor zoeken,
Succes,
Groet,
Walter
Software modeltreinen |
|
|
robpnl
Netherlands
22 Posts |
Geplaatst - 18 dec 2007 : 07:24:36
|
Bedankt Walter,
betekent dit, dat als ik als ik bij een variabele route in de stamgegevens aangeef dat een blok uitgesloten is, ik bij richtingsverbod alle bewegingen van en naar uitgesloten blokken niet hoef aan te vinken?. Ik heb dit nu wel gedaan. In stamgegevens staat dat slechts de blokken 1,2 6 en 7 bereden mogen worden. In richtingsverbod staat dat slechts de bewegingen tussen deze blokken zijn toegestaan.
groet, Rob |
|
|
PaHaSOFT
3413 Posts |
Geplaatst - 18 dec 2007 : 07:41:36
|
Rob,
In een richtingsverbod kan je niets toestaan. Uit jouw laatste bijdrage lees ik dit wel (of ik lees het verkeerd).
Als een blok is uitgesloten dan heeft een richtingsverbod naar dit blok geen zin. Koploper controleert er niet op tijdens invoer.
Een richtingsverbod is bedoeld voor een blok waar vanuit 1 richting wel treinen mogen inrijden en vanuit een andere richting niet. Wanneer een blok volledig is uitgesloten, zal de trein er van geen enkele kant in kunnen rijden en dus hebben richtingsverboden dan ook geen zin.
Mvg, Paul. |
|
|
robpnl
Netherlands
22 Posts |
Geplaatst - 18 dec 2007 : 15:17:11
|
Bedankt Paul, ik ga, zoals Walter al voorstelde, alle overtollige richtingverboden er uit halen.
groet, Rob |
|
|
robpnl
Netherlands
22 Posts |
Geplaatst - 19 dec 2007 : 08:34:00
|
Ik heb alle richtingverboden verwijderd, maar dat maakte niet uit. Wat mij nu pas opviel, was dat de loks in plaats van varialel op vaste routes werden gestuurd. Het waren de hen toegewezen vaste routes, maar .... ik had toch duidelijk 'variabele routes' aangevinkt! Blijkbaar wordt dit overruled. Klopt het dat als je voor een lok zowel variabele als ook vaste routes hebt gedefinieerd en je in automatisch rijden (F8) het rijden start door de lok naar een vrij blok te slepen, de lok nadat hij dit blok bereikt heeft verder gaat op hem toegewezen vaste routes? Dit terwijl in de eigenschappen van de lok aangevinkt staat dat deze via variabele routes dient te rijden?
groet, Rob |
|
|
PaHaSOFT
3413 Posts |
Geplaatst - 19 dec 2007 : 10:53:18
|
Rob,
Jij vinkt helemaal niet aan bij een loc of deze rijdt volgens vaste of variabele routes. Er is in het rijwindow te weinig ruimte om beide te laten zien.
Je geeft in een rijwindow op welke variabele treinroutes van toepassing zijn. Je kan ook opgeven welke vaste treinroute voor die loc gelden. Rijdt de loc gewoon automatisch (en dus niet via een vaste route) en de loc komt langs combinatie richtingsblok / eerste blok uit vaste treinroute dan zal indien die vaste treinroute is aangevinkt de vaste treinroute starten.
Mvg, Paul. |
|
|
robpnl
Netherlands
22 Posts |
Geplaatst - 19 dec 2007 : 13:24:47
|
Bedankt Paul voor je snelle en duidelijke uitleg. Nu weet ik hoe de vork in de steel zit. De vormgeving van het tabblad 'rijgedrag' behorende bij een lokomotief heeft mij blijkbaar op het verkeerde been gezet. Omdat je om bij de treinroute(s) een type moet selecteren, ging ik er van uit dat de lok dan ook enkel via dat type route zou rijden. Dus òf variabele routes òf vaste routes. Ik had anders tabbladen verwacht. Ik ga mijn database aanpassen. Ik heb via marktplaats een paar S88's besteld. tussen kerst en oud en nieuw ga ik eens experimenteren met automatisch rangeren.
groet, Rob |
|
|
PaHaSOFT
3413 Posts |
Geplaatst - 19 dec 2007 : 15:08:54
|
Rob,
Voordat jij automatisch gaat rangeren, zorg dan eerst dat je automatisch kan rijden. Rangeren is hogere Koploperkunde. Hiervoor is het wel noodzakelijk dat je goed weet hoe Koploper werkt. Zelf rangeer ik niet. Ik denk niet dat ik je daar bij veel kan helpen.
Mvg, Paul. |
|
|
|
Onderwerp |
|